Post by torcan on Jul 2, 2010 18:44:44 GMT -5
No, that would go to the Beatles Medley (the one by the Beatles, not Stars On 45). The song peaked at #12 for three weeks in May, 1982, fell to #20, then took a humongous drop to #92 the week after that. That's a 72-point drop, my friend, somewhat dwarfing the 56-notch fall of "Kiss In The Dark". I never understood how songs dropped so fast from their peak positions. I know that part of it had to do with the rule at the time of forcing songs to stay in the same positions while they lost their "stars" ("bullets"), but the charts were weird in 1982 that the drops seemed bigger than ever. Quite frequently that year songs would drop from the top 20 all the way down to the '80s or '90s. You didn't see it very often in other years. I can certainly understand songs dropping off the top 40 if they've peaked in the 30s (even while moving up), and sometimes in the lower 20s. I'm surprised that songs as high as the top 20 or even top 10 would fall right out of the countdown. There was a time when Casey didn't mention the week's droppers. Fans keeping track at home must have wondered what happened! To me, it doesn't seem realistic that songs would drop so quickly from their peaks - Donna Summer moving from 11 to 10, then the next week dropping to 59? ELO peaking at 13 then dropping right out with "All Over the World"? Donna Summer's "Muscles" spending so long at No. 10 the losing a spot in the top 40 in just one week? Interesting charts back then
